Note: Very faint loop CME seen to the E in SOHO LASCO C2/C3 and STEREO A COR2. Source is very faint field line movement seen beyond the E limb in GOES SUVI 304/284 imagery, with a small amount of material (it did not fully escape and become ejecta) possibly associated with the eruption, starting around 2024-11-27T08:50Z. General field line movement and a very gradual 'thinning'/dimming/opening of field lines can be seen when toggling through GOES SUVI 284 imagery between 2024-11-27T08:00Z-14:00Z. GOES SUVI used for analysis; outage in SDO affecting all SDO data product timestamps starting at about 2024-11-26T23:52Z.

Measurement TypeCME measurement type: Leading Edge (LE), Shock Front (SH), Right Hand Boundary (RHB), Left Hand Boundary (LHB), Black/White Boundary (BW), Prominence Core (COR), Disconnection Front (DIS), Trailing Edge (TE).
Prime?"primary flag" which is either True or False. If there are multiple CME analysis entries for a single CME, this flag would indicate which analysis is considered most accurate per measurement type. This is a helpful flag if you would like to download only one most accurate CME analysis per CME per Measurement Type
